  • Title

    Tagging with DHARMA, a DHT-based approach for resource mapping through approximation

  • Abstract
    We introduce collaborative tagging and faceted search on structured P2P systems. Since a trivial and brute force mapping of an entire folksonomy over a DHT-based system may reduce scalability, we propose an approximated graph maintenance approach. Evaluations on real data coming from Last.fm prove that such strategies reduce vocabulary noise (i.e., representation´s overfitting phenomena) and hotspots issues.
